Stackable Modular Office Building for Space-Saving Solutions
Product Overview
- Vertical Stability: Engineered with a stackable framework featuring Q235 steel square tube columns, C-section roofing/purlins, and L40*3 cross bracings to support multi-level configurations.
- Anchoring Foundation: Secured using heavy-duty M16 chemical bolts and 4.8S zinc-plated ordinary bolts, enabling stable vertical expansion and maximum footprint efficiency.
- Enclosure Architecture: Wrapped in 50mm/75mm/100mm Rockwool sandwich insulation panels for walls and roofs, completed with secure 850mm*2030mm insulated steel doors.
- Multi-Zone Interiors: Structured with distinct dry areas (gypsum board ceilings and vinyl floor leather) and wet areas (calcium silicate ceilings with keels and ceramic tiles).
- Grid Infrastructure: Pre-fitted with a 220V/60Hz LED electrical grid, 10A/16A junction-box sockets, dedicated AC/heater lines, and complete integrated sanitary plumbing (toilet, washbasin, shower).

Frequently Asked Questions
How many levels high can this modular building system safely stack to save space?
Thanks to the high-strength Q235 square tube columns, C-section steel frames, and heavy-duty L40*3 cross bracings, this system is structurally engineered for safe multi-story vertical stacking. To ensure complete stability, the ground columns are anchored into the foundation using high-tensile M16 chemical bolts.
Will noise from the upper office floor disturb workers in the office directly below?
No. The building addresses vertical noise transfer by utilizing thick Rockwool sandwich panels (available up to 100mm) in the flooring and roofing systems. This high-density insulation acts as an effective acoustic barrier, ensuring a quiet, professional working environment on every level.
How are the plumbing and drainage systems managed when units are stacked vertically?
Each module features a standardized utility layout with integrated input and output water pipes. When units are stacked, the plumbing lines for the toilets, washbasins, and showers are aligned and connected through a centralized vertical service riser, preventing leaks and simplifying site installation.
Can we configure the top level with windows and the ground level as a secure storage office?
Yes. The modular design allows you to mix and match panels. You can place secure, insulated steel doors on the ground level, and install double-glazed PVC sliding windows with integrated blinds on the upper levels to maximize natural light and viewpoints.
How is electricity safely distributed from the ground grid up to the higher floors?
Every individual office unit comes pre-wired with its own distribution cabinet, switches, and earth-leakage protective devices. Main power lines route up through designated weatherproof conduits, supplying independent 220V power to the lighting, AC lines, and 10A/16A sockets of each stacked level.
